Callnexthookex参数
Web看堆栈可以看到充当回调函数的是user32.dll中的函数,user32.dll也就是参数HOOKPROCl pfn的实际过程 总结一下上述操作的顺序 好了,历经6个小时,终于写完了这一课,大家一定要自己亲手操作来学习,切不可走马观花,下一课会讲DLL注入,比这一课难很多,如果这节 ... WebDec 8, 2010 · CallNextHookEx(hKeyboardHook, nCode, wParam, lParam) Return 1 告诉系统,丢弃该消息。当然出于礼貌,在之前还是调用CallNextHookEx函数,以便其他的钩 …
Callnexthookex参数
Did you know?
WebApr 18, 2014 · 在“ 键盘监控的实现Ⅱ——容易产生误解的CallNextHookEx函数 ”中,提到按键消息的修改是不能通过更改参数调用CallNextHookEx函数来实现的。. 本文就是要解决这个问题,如何来实现按键消息的修改。. 这里我们要引入一个函数. Private Declare Sub keybd_event Lib "user32 ... Web参数: idHook: 这个参数可以是以下值: ... 原形:LRESULT CallNextHookEx( HHOOK hhk, int nCode, WPARAM wParam, LPARAM lParam ) CallNexHookEx()函数用于对当前钩子链中的下一个钩子进程传递钩子信息,一个钩子进程既可以在钩子信息处理前,也可以在钩子信息处理后调用该函数。
Web其中,第一个参数是钩子的类型;第二个参数是钩子函数的地址;第三个参数是包含钩子函数的模块句柄;第四个参数指定监视的线程。 ... 在完成对消息的处理后,如果想要该消息继续传递,那么它必须调用另外一个SDK中的API函数CallNextHookEx来传递它。钩子函数 ... WebOct 12, 2024 · Remarks. Hook procedures are installed in chains for particular hook types. CallNextHookEx calls the next hook in the chain. Calling CallNextHookEx is optional, but it is highly recommended; otherwise, other applications that have installed hooks will not receive hook notifications and may behave incorrectly as a result.
WebSep 27, 2024 · CallNextHookEx 调用链中的下一个挂钩。 调用 CallNextHookEx 是可选的,但强烈建议这样做:否则,已安装挂钩的其他应用程序将不会收到挂钩通知,因此行 … WebOct 30, 2024 · Hook函数三步走(SetWindowsHookEx、UnhookWindowsHookEx、CallNextHookEx),文章目录Hook(Windows系统机制)Hook定义Hook原理系统钩子与线程钩子钩子函数设置钩子:SetWindowsHookEx参数说明:释放钩子:UnhookWindowsHookEx继续钩子:CallNextHookExHook小案例Hook(Windows系 …
WebCallNextHookEx 免费编辑 添加义项名. CallNextHookEx. B 添加义项. ? 所属类别 : 函数. CallNextHookEx是一种函数,可以将钩子信息传递到当前钩子链中的下一个子程,一个 …
Web第四个参数为线程的ID,若为全局钩子这个参数设置为0,若是线程钩子可以使用GetCurrentThreadId来获得当前线程的ID. 返回值:若调用成功,返回的是这个钩子过程 … sharpercraftWebDec 8, 2010 · 甚至认为,修改CallNextHookEx函数的参数就能更改按键消息的传递。 遗憾的是,这个思路是不对的。 你可以在钩子函数中删除CallNextHookEx函数的调用,会发现Window还是得到了按键的消息。你也可以尝试修改CallNextHookEx函数的参数,看看会有 … sharper cast listWebDec 8, 2010 · CallNextHookEx(hKeyboardHook, nCode, wParam, lParam) Return 1 告诉系统,丢弃该消息。当然出于礼貌,在之前还是调用CallNextHookEx函数,以便其他的钩 … sharpercore viewerWebJan 21, 2024 · 该消息框包含一个应用程序定义的消息和标题,加上预定义的图标和按钮的任意组合。 wLanguageId参数指定为预定义的按钮使用的语言资源集。 .参数 hwnd, 整数型, , 要创建的消息框的所有者窗口的句柄。 sharper counseling llcWeb参数: idHook: 这个参数可以是以下值: ... 原形:LRESULT CallNextHookEx( HHOOK hhk, int nCode, WPARAM wParam, LPARAM lParam ) CallNexHookEx()函数用于对当前 … sharper cutWeb参数wParam和 lParam包含所钩消息的信息,比如鼠标位置、状态,键盘按键等。 nCode包含有关消息本身的信息,比如是否从消息队列中移出。 我们先在钩子函数中实现自定义的功能,然后调用函数 CallNextHookEx.把钩子信息传递给钩子链的下一个钩子函数。 sharpercut pittsburghWebOct 31, 2012 · nCode参数是Hook代码,Hook子程使用这个参数来确定任务。这个参数的值依赖于Hook类型,每一种Hook都有自己的Hook代码特征字符集。 ... 在完成对消息的处理后,如果想要该消息继续传递,那么它必须调用另外一个SDK中的API函数CallNextHookEx来传递它,以执行钩子链表 ... pork katsu with pickled cucumbers and shiso